Libya oil

The US Finance and Energy website says Libya holds the second-largest crude oil reserves in Africa.

Libya came after Africa's top oil producer, Nigeria, with 1.2 million b/d, followed by Angola, Algeria, and Egypt, respectively, with 1.1, 1.06 million, and 460 thousand b/d.

The US website said that Libya, which is recovering from the OPEC Plus agreement, is witnessing a rapid recovery compared to last year, though political instability is still impacting the country's production.

The report anticipated that Libya's production of oil would remain stable throughout 2023, with the accelerating of exploration operations and its possession of 48 billion barrels of crude oil reserves.
